.findaworkshop_contents{font-family:Arial,sans-serif;background-color:#fff;color:#333333;max-width:1240px;margin:0 auto;font-weight:400;}.header{color:#fff;background-color:#ec1300;max-width:1240px;height:100px;display:flex;align-items:center;}.header_container{width:96%;margin:0 auto;display:flex;justify-content:space-between;}.logo{padding:0 15px;}.logo img{top:4px;position:relative;}.header_links{display:flex;align-items:center;}.lists{display:flex;align-items:center;justify-content:center;}.list-inline-item{list-style-type:none;padding:0 15px;}.list-inline-item:last-child{padding-right:0;}.list-inline-item a,.list-inline-item p{color:#fff;text-decoration:none;font-weight:900;cursor:pointer;}.hero_heading{font-family:Source sans pro;font-weight:900;color:#ec1300;}.hero_buttons{display:flex;justify-content:center;flex-direction:column;}.button{background:#ec1300;color:#fff;margin:0px 28px 25px 0px;font-size:18px;font-weight:700;border-radius:50px;text-decoration:none;transition:all 0.3s ease;display:flex;justify-content:center;align-items:center;height:47px;width:314px;cursor:pointer;}.findaworkshop_contents.button:hover{text-decoration:none;background:#b7170b;color:#fff;}.findaworkshop_text,.events_heading{color:#000;font-weight:700;}@media screen and(max-width:767px){.header{height:165px;max-width:100%;align-items:unset;}.header_container{width:100%;flex-wrap:wrap;flex-direction:column;}.logo{padding:26px 0 18px;margin:0 auto;flex:0 0 50%;text-align:center;}.logo img{width:auto;height:38px;top:0;}.header_links{margin:0 auto;}.lists{max-width:320px;margin:0 auto;flex-wrap:wrap;justify-content:space-between;}.list-inline-item{padding:0 0 15px 0;width:50%;text-align:center;}.list-inline-item a,.list-inline-item p{font-weight:700;font-size:12px;line-height:24px;font-family:"Lato",sans-serif;text-transform:uppercase;}.list-inline-item:not(:last-child){margin-right:0px;}.hero_heading{font-size:45px;line-height:43px;letter-spacing:-2px;margin:0 auto;text-align:center;width:100%;padding:30px 15px 0;}.hero_text{font-size:20px;line-height:26px;width:309px;margin:35px auto 40px;text-align:center;}.hero_buttons{align-items:center;}.button{margin:0;font-size:16px;width:307px;height:51px;}#volunteer-btn{width:307px;margin:15px 0 40px;}.hero_img{width:100%;margin:0 auto;height:auto;}.findaworkshop_text{font-size:24px;line-height:25px;margin:30px auto 31px;width:310px;}.events_heading{font-size:20px;line-height:22px;margin:30px auto 40px;width:303px;}}@media screen and(min-width:768px){.header{height:8.34vw;}.logo img{width:75%;}.list-inline-item a,.list-inline-item p{font-size:calc(11px+(18-11)*((100vw-768px)/(1250-768)));line-height:1.52vw;}.list-inline-item{padding:0 1.2vw 0 0;}.list-inline-item:last-child{padding-right:0;}.hero{display:flex;}.hero_left{padding-left:4.032vw;}.hero_heading{margin:3.6vw 6.2vw 3.6vw 0;font-size:calc(61px+(100-61)*((100vw-768px)/(1250-768)));line-height:6.72vw;letter-spacing:-0.3vw;}.hero_text{font-size:calc(15px+(25-15)*((100vw-768px)/(1250-768)));line-height:2.5vw;padding-right:3vw;margin-bottom:3.04vw;}.hero_img{width:51.9vw;height:53.6vw;position:relative;}.button{margin:0vw 2.24vw 2vw 0vw;font-size:calc(11px+(18-11)*((100vw-768px)/(1250-768)));border-radius:4vw;height:3.76vw;width:25.12vw;}#volunteer-btn{width:28vw;}.findaworkshop_text{font-size:calc(26px+(42-26)*((100vw-768px)/(1200-768)));line-height:4vw;margin-top:2.16vw;margin-left:5.04vw;margin-right:0.833vw;}.events_heading{font-size:calc(19px+(30-19)*((100vw-768px)/(1200-768)));line-height:2.72vw;margin:3.84vw 0 2.56vw 5.04vw;width:82.4vw;}}@media screen and(min-width:1200px){.header{height:100px;}.logo img{width:100%;}.list-inline-item{padding:0 15px;}.list-inline-item a,.list-inline-item p{font-size:18px;line-height:19px;}.hero_left{padding-left:50px;}.hero_heading{font-size:100px;line-height:84px;letter-spacing:-5px;margin:63px 70px 48px 0;}.hero_text{font-size:27px;line-height:33px;width:459px;margin-bottom:38px;padding:0;}.button{margin:0px 28px 25px 0px;font-size:18px;border-radius:50px;height:47px;width:314px;}#volunteer-btn{width:350px;}.hero_img{width:646px;height:683px;}.findaworkshop_text{font-size:42px;line-height:50px;margin-top:27px;margin-left:63px;margin-right:0;}.events_heading{font-size:30px;line-height:34px;margin:48px 0 45px 63px;width:1030px;}}@media screen and(min-width:1200px)and(max-width:1250px){.hero_heading{font-size:calc(61px+(100-61)*((100vw-768px)/(1250-768)));}}*{margin:0;padding:0;box-sizing:border-box;}
a,ol,li,p,h1{font-size:unset;line-height:unset;padding:unset;}
body{margin:0 auto;padding:0;max-width:1440px;font-family:"Lato",sans-serif;font-size:12px;line-height:1.42857143;}
footer{padding:1.5rem 0;line-height:1.42857143;}.aarp-c-footer-lp__content{width:100%;max-width:1100px;margin:0 auto;box-sizing:border-box;}.aarp-c-footer-lp__content-links-ul a{font-size:18px;}.aarp-c-footer-lp{background-color:rgb(51,51,51);padding:1rem 0;}.aarp-c-footer-lp__content-links-ul li{color:#ffffff;list-style-type:none;border-left:none;padding-bottom:6px;}.aarp-c-footer-lp__content-links li a{text-decoration:none;color:#fff;padding:0 9px;font-size:18px;border-left:2px solid#ffffff;width:fit-content;}.aarp-c-footer-lp__content-links-ul{list-style:none;display:flex;justify-content:center;align-items:center;flex-wrap:wrap;width:100%;margin:0 auto;padding:0 15px;}.aarp-c-footer-lp__content-links li a:hover{text-decoration:underline;}.aarp-c-footer-lp__content-links li:last-child{border-right:none;width:fit-content;}.aarp-c-footer-lp__content-links-ul li:first-child a{border-left:none;}@media(min-width:768px){.aarp-c-footer-lp__content-links\@tablet ul a{font-size:12px;}.aarp-c-footer-lp\@tablet{padding:1rem 0;}}@media(min-width:986px){.aarp-c-footer-lp__content-links ul a{font-size:14px;}.aarp-c-footer-lp{padding:1.5rem 0;}}@media(min-width:1200px){.aarp-c-footer-lp__content-links ul a{font-size:18px;}}@media(max-width:767px){.aarp-c-footer-lp__content-links\@mobile li a{font-size:12px;padding:0 8px;}}@import url("https://fonts.googleapis.com/css?family=Source+Sans+Pro:400,900&amp;display=swap");html{-webkit-text-size-adjust:100%;}.findaworkshop_contents{font-family:Arial,sans-serif;background-color:#fff;color:#333333;max-width:1240px;margin:0 auto;font-weight:400;}.aarp-c-footer-lp{max-width:1240px;margin:0 auto;}*{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:0;padding:0;visibility:visible;}*:focus{outline:none;}.des-dis{display:block;}.mob-dis{display:none;}.header{color:#fff;background-color:#ec1300;max-width:1240px;display:flex;align-items:center;}.findaworkshop_contents.button:hover{text-decoration:none;background:#b7170b;color:#fff;}.findaworkshop_text,.events_heading{color:#000;font-weight:700;}#ClickHere{cursor:pointer;}.areas_code{font-weight:700;}.areas_name a{font-weight:500;text-decoration:underline;color:#337ab7;width:auto;}.findaworkshop_contents.areas_name a:hover{color:#23527c;text-decoration:underline;}.altsec-maintxt{font-weight:700;}.alt_buttons{background:#d8d8d8;color:#000;font-weight:800;border-radius:50px;text-decoration:none;display:flex;justify-content:center;align-items:center;font-family:'Lato';}.findaworkshop_contents.alt_buttons:hover{color:#23527c;}.alt_text{text-align:center;}.hline{height:2px;background:#000;margin:0 auto 31px;overflow:hidden;}.footerLogos{text-align:center;display:flex;justify-content:center;align-items:flex-end;}.footerLogos div p{color:#666;}.toyotaLogo{display:none!important;}.disclaimer_txt p{font-family:"Source sans Pro",sans seriff;color:#666;}.disclaimer_txt p a,.findaworkshop_contents.disclaimer_txt p a:hover{color:#666;text-decoration:underline;}.clickHere{color:#337ab7;text-decoration:none;}.findaworkshop_contents.clickHere:hover{color:#23527c;}.modal{display:block;max-width:700px;margin:0 auto;position:fixed;top:0;right:0;bottom:0;left:0;z-index:1050;display:none;overflow:hidden;-webkit-overflow-scrolling:touch;outline:0;}.modal-body{position:relative;padding:15px;}.close{font-size:21px;font-weight:700;line-height:1;color:#000;text-shadow:0 1px 0#fff;float:right;cursor:pointer;position:relative;visibility:hidden;left:18px;opacity:unset;}.close::after,.close::before{content:"";position:absolute;background:0 0;border-style:solid;border-width:4px 0 0 4px;padding:4px;right:0;top:0;transform:rotate(-45deg);visibility:visible;color:#000;margin:0 10px 0px 0;}.close::after{border-width:0 4px 4px 0;right:11px;}.close:focus,.findaworkshop_contents.close:hover{color:#000;text-decoration:none;cursor:pointer;filter:alpha(opacity=50);opacity:0.5;}.videoPlayer1{width:100%;height:95%;}.video-js{display:block;box-sizing:border-box;color:#fff;background-color:#000;position:relative;padding:0;font-size:10px;line-height:1;font-weight:400;font-style:normal;font-family:Arial,Helvetica,sans-serif;word-break:initial;cursor:pointer;}.overlay{width:100%;height:100%;position:fixed;top:0;left:0;background:rgba(0,0,0,0.4);display:none;}.evSection{font-family:'Lato';max-width:1240px;margin-bottom:30px;}.evSection q{color:#ec1300;}@media screen and(max-width:767px){.des-dis{display:none;}.mob-dis{display:block;}.Areas_Section{width:320px;margin:0 auto;padding:0 15px;}.areas_code{font-size:20px;font-weight:700;margin:0;line-height:25px;}.areas_name{margin:0 0 20px;font-size:20px;line-height:25px;text-decoration:underline;color:#337ab7;}.signup-section{margin-top:57px;}.altsec-maintxt{font-size:20px;width:276px;margin:0 auto 44px;}.Alt_Lrnsec{width:276px;margin:0 auto;}.alt_buttons{margin:0 28px 25px 0;font-size:18px;height:50px;width:267px;}.alt_text{font-size:14px;line-height:18px;margin-bottom:10px;}.Alt_subsec.altsub_online{padding:23px 0 0;}.hline{padding:0px 20px;margin:0 auto 40px;}.bottomContent{padding:45px 30px 0;}.footerLogos{flex-flow:column;margin:0 0 26px;}.toyotaLogo,.hartfordLogo{margin:0 10px;display:block;display:flex;margin:0 20px;justify-content:center;align-items:flex-end;}.hartfordLogo img{width:80px;height:auto;}.toyotaLogo{padding-top:15px;padding-left:10px;}.toyotaLogo img{width:26%;height:auto;}.footerLogos div p{font-size:12px;padding-left:20px;text-align:left;font-family:"Source Sans Pro",sans-serif;}.disclaimer_txt{margin:0 auto;padding:0 20px 20px;}.disclaimer_txt p{font-size:13px;line-height:18px;margin-bottom:10px;}.modal{padding:10px;max-width:340px;height:234px;margin:auto;}.modal-body{position:relative;padding:15px;background:#fff;border-radius:10px;height:215px;}.videoPlayer1{width:275px;height:175px;margin:0 auto;}.vjs-tech{width:275px;height:170px;margin:0 auto;}#smartdriveVideo{width:100%;height:97%;}.evSection{display:flex;flex-direction:column;padding:0 30px;}.evSection.evSection__heading{font-size:24px;line-height:125%;font-weight:800;margin-bottom:20px;}.evSection.evSection__description,.evSection.evSection__points{font-size:18px;line-height:150%;font-weight:400;margin-bottom:30px;}.evSection.evSection__points{margin-bottom:30px;margin-left:15px;}.evSection.evSection__right{max-width:100%;margin-top:30px;}.evSection__button{display:flex;align-items:center;justify-content:center;}.evSection.evSection_img{max-width:100%;}}@media screen and(min-width:768px){.Areas_Section,.area_code_name{display:flex;}.sub_sectionleft{margin-left:6.32vw;}.sub_sectionright{margin-left:10.96vw;}.areas_code{font-size:calc(16px+(24-16)*((100vw-768px)/(1200-768)));width:3.629vw;line-height:3.629vw;margin-bottom:10px;}.areas_name{margin:0 0 0 2.581vw;}.areas_name a{font-size:calc(16px+(24-16)*((100vw-768px)/(1200-768)));line-height:3.548vw;}.container1{margin-top:4.88vw;}.altsec-maintxt{font-size:calc(19px+(30-19)*((100vw-768px)/(1200-768)));line-height:2.72vw;font-weight:700;margin-left:5.12vw;margin-bottom:10px;}.Alt_subsec{width:50%;display:flex;flex-direction:column;align-items:center;}.alt_online{display:flex;justify-content:center;flex-direction:column;}.Alt_Lrnsec{display:flex;justify-content:center;margin:0 auto;width:84.08vw;}.alt_buttons{font-size:calc(12px+(18-12)*((100vw-768px)/(1200-768)));height:4vw;width:28.96vw;margin:3.04vw 2.24vw 2.24vw 0px;}.alt_text{font-size:calc(16px+(24-16)*((100vw-768px)/(1200-768)));line-height:1.42857143;width:30.88vw;margin-bottom:10px;}.hline{height:0.16vw;margin:0 auto 2.48vw;}.bottomContent{padding:5%0 2%;}.hartfordLogo img{width:8.41vw;height:auto;}.hartfordLogo{display:inline-block;margin:0 20px;}.toyotaLogo img{width:6.771vw;height:auto;}.footerLogos{margin:0 0 26px;}.footerLogos div p{font-weight:400;font-size:calc(12px+(20-12)*((100vw-768px)/(1250-768)));padding-left:1.563vw;color:#333;}.disclaimer_txt{margin:0 auto;max-width:1140px;width:84.5vw;padding:0 0 2vw;}.disclaimer_txt p{text-align:left;font-size:calc(12px+(17-12)*((100vw-768px)/(1200-768)));line-height:1.76vw;margin-bottom:10px;}.modal{max-width:55.32vw;}.modal-body{position:fixed;top:30%;left:50%;transform:translate(-50%,-50%);z-index:9999999;background:#fff;border-radius:0.8vw;}#smartdriveVideo{width:100%;height:97%;}#videoPlayer1,.vjs-tech,.modal-body{width:55.5vw;height:34.28vw;margin:0 auto;}.evSection{display:flex;flex-direction:row;margin:auto 5.04vw 30px;}.evSection.evSection__heading{font-size:26px;line-height:125%;font-weight:800;margin-bottom:20px;}.evSection.evSection__description,.evSection.evSection__points{font-size:20px;line-height:150%;font-weight:400;margin-bottom:30px;}.evSection.evSection__points{margin-bottom:30px;margin-left:18px;}.evSection__left{margin-right:32px;}.evSection.evSection__right{max-width:50%;}.evSection.evSection_img{width:-webkit-fill-available;}.evSection__button.button{margin:0;}}@media screen and(min-width:1200px){.evSection{margin:auto 0 40px 64px;}.evSection__left{margin-right:64px;margin-top:10px;}.evSection.evSection__heading{font-size:30px;line-height:125%;font-weight:800;margin-bottom:20px;}.evSection__button.button{margin:0;}.sub_sectionleft{margin-left:79px;}.areas_code{font-size:24px;line-height:44px;width:45px;margin-bottom:0;}.areas_name{margin:0 0 0 32px;}.areas_name a{font-size:24px;line-height:44px;}.sub_sectionleft{margin-left:79px;}.sub_sectionright{margin-left:137px;}.container1{margin-top:61px;}.altsec-maintxt{font-size:30px;line-height:34px;margin-left:64px;margin-bottom:10px;}.Alt_Lrnsec{width:1051px;}.alt_buttons{font-size:18px;height:50px;width:362px;margin:38px 28px 28px 0px;}.alt_text{font-size:24px;width:386px;margin-bottom:10px;}.hline{height:2px;margin:0 auto 31px;}.bottomContent{padding:50px 0 20px;}.toyotaLogo,.hartfordLogo{margin:0 20px;}.hartfordLogo img{width:90px;height:auto;}.footerLogos div p{font-size:13px;line-height:1.42857143;padding-left:20px;margin-bottom:0;color:#666;}.toyotaLogo,.hartfordLogo{display:flex;justify-content:center;align-items:flex-end;}.toyotaLogo img{width:85px;height:auto;vertical-align:initial;}.disclaimer_txt{width:100%;padding:10px 0 30px;margin:0 auto;max-width:1140px;}.disclaimer_txt p{font-size:17px;line-height:22px;}.modal{max-width:700px;}.modal-body{top:50%;left:50%;border-radius:10px;width:700px;height:467px;}#videoPlayer1,.vjs-tech{width:670px;height:416px;}#smartdriveVideo{width:100%;height:100%;}}@media screen and(min-width:1200px)and(max-width:1250px){.hero_heading{font-size:calc(61px+(100-61)*((100vw-768px)/(1250-768)));}}